Research at the Arboretum

Since opening in 2013, the Arboretum has partnered with Universities, citizen science groups and volunteers to undertake studies from tree growth, climate change research to survey work. The Australian National University research forests provide undergraduate and graduate students the opportunity to study trees, soils and climate using cutting edge technology in a dedicated and unique environment.
